Crucial Security Equipment to Have Onboard
While you could be delighted to hit the water, it's essential to guarantee you have the vital security tools onboard. First and leading, life vest are a need to for everybody on the boat; see to it they're Coast Guard-approved and in shape effectively. Next, an emergency treatment set ought to be equipped with standard products to take care of minor injuries. You'll also intend to have a fire extinguisher easily accessible, along with flares or a signaling tool for emergencies. A whistle or horn can aid signal others if you're in distress.Don' t neglect to load a throwable flotation protection tool, like a pillow or ring, in case a person falls crazy. When you need to stop, a support and rope are required for stability. Ultimately, make particular you have actually got a totally charged cell phone or aquatic radio for interaction. Being prepared not only keeps you risk-free yet likewise allows you appreciate your boating adventure to the max!
Local Rules and Boating Rules

Required Safety And Security Devices
Safety on the water begins with recognizing the required safety and security devices mandated by local policies and boating regulations. Before you set out, ensure your watercraft is equipped with life coats for everyone aboard. Many states need a personal flotation protection tool for each guest, so do not miss this crucial action. You'll also need a fire extinguisher, specifically if your boat has an engine. Look for a sound-producing device, like a whistle or horn, to indicate for help in an emergency. In addition, keep an emergency treatment set convenient for minor injuries. Some locations might need aesthetic call for help, like flares. Familiarize on your own with these basics to guarantee a risk-free and delightful boating experience.

Regional Speed Limitations
Regional rate restrictions are a necessary part of boating guidelines that you need to recognize. Each location has specific rate limits to assure safety and protect the setting. Always check local policies prior to you go out; they can differ substantially from one place to one more. In some zones, like near anchors or swimming areas, limits could be reduced to avoid accidents. Stopping working to stick to these restrictions can bring about fines or, even worse, dangerous circumstances. You must likewise be mindful of wake areas, where your watercraft's wake can create damages to coastlines or various other vessels. By respecting these local rate restrictions, you'll aid assure a satisfying and safe experience for yourself and others on the water.

Standard Boating Skills Every Newbie Ought To Know
Boating can be an exciting experience, however understanding a couple of basic skills is crucial for each beginner. First, obtain comfortable with guiding. Technique guiding and making use of the throttle wheel to understand exactly how the boat reacts. Next, learn to dock. Approach the dock at a slow-moving speed, and utilize fenders to protect both your watercraft and the dock.Understanding navigating is likewise crucial. Familiarize yourself with basic nautical terms and read the water, identifying buoys and markers.Another key skill is anchoring. Know just how to go down the support and ensure it holds securely to avoid wandering. Finally, always technique precaution. Put on life vest, examine weather, and understand emergency procedures.
